Transaction 2aa4107bf53e8531b15b7d9b2eb95dcfde32b2582f24fe1d8643ca7c6d4b6d55
1 Input
1 Output
-
2aa4107bf53e8531b15b7d9b2eb95dcfde32b2582f24fe1d8643ca7c6d4b6d55:0
- value
- 23261408
- script pubkey
- OP_0 OP_PUSHBYTES_20 a670dd3f83a48de3c8be87e6b2e35874a044afc3
- address
- bc1q5ecd60ur5jx78j97slnt9c6cwjsyft7rwls8x6